orderly詞典解釋
1. 有秩序的;按部就班的
If something is done in an orderly fashion or manner, it is done in a well-organized and controlled way.
e.g. The organizers guided them in orderly fashion out of the building...
組織者引領(lǐng)他們井然有序地走出大樓。
e.g. Despite the violence that preceded the elections, reports say that polling was orderly and peaceful.
盡管選舉前發(fā)生了暴力事件,報道說(shuō)投票得以和平有序地進(jìn)行。
2. 整潔的;有條理的
Something that is orderly is neat or arranged in a neat way.

e.g. It's a beautiful, clean and orderly city...
這是一座美麗清潔、秩序井然的城市。
e.g. Their vehicles were parked in orderly rows.
他們的車(chē)一排排井然有序地停放著(zhù)。
3. (醫院的)勤雜工,護理員
An orderly is a person who works in a hospital and does jobs that do not require special medical training.
orderly英英釋義
noun
1. a male hospital attendant who has general duties that do not involve the medical treatment of patients
Synonym: hospital attendant
2. a soldier who serves as an attendant to a superior officer
e.g. the orderly laid out the general's uniform
adj
1. devoid of violence or disruption
e.g. an orderly crowd confronted the president
2. clean or organized
